Driveway brick repair services involve fixing damaged or deteriorated brick surfaces to restore their appearance and functionality. Over time, exposure to weather, regular use, and shifting ground can cause bricks to crack, loosen, or settle unevenly. Repair work typically includes replacing broken or missing bricks, re-leveling uneven sections, and sealing gaps to prevent further damage. Skilled service providers use appropriate techniques to ensure the repairs blend seamlessly with the existing driveway, helping to maintain a smooth and safe surface for vehicles and pedestrians.
Many common problems lead property owners to seek driveway brick repair. Cracks and crumbling bricks can pose safety hazards and diminish curb appeal. Settling or heaving may cause the surface to become uneven, increasing the risk of tripping or vehicle damage. Additionally, gaps and loose bricks can allow water to seep underneath, leading to further deterioration and potential foundation issues. The overview below groups typical Driveway Brick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Aurora,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or brick repair or patching range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Moderate Repairs - Replacing several bricks or fixing larger sections usually costs between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ners looking to restore appearance and stability.
Full Driveway Restoration - Complete repairs or resurfacing of a driveway can range from $1,500 to $3,500, with many projects in this band. Larger or more complex restorations may push costs higher but are less frequent.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ire driveway with new brickwork typically costs $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Such extensive projects are less common and depend on driveway size and design compl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of driveway brick repairs are commonly handled by local contractors? Local contractors often address cracked bricks, loose or uneven pavers, and damaged or missing bricks to restore driveway stability and appearance.
How can I tell if my driveway bricks need repair? Signs include visible cracks, uneven surfaces, loose bricks, or areas where bricks are sinking or shifting out of place.
What are some common causes of driveway brick damage? Damage can result from freeze-thaw cycles, heavy vehicle traffic, soil movement, or improper installation over time.
Are driveway brick repairs suitable for all types of brick or pavers? Many local service providers work with various brick and paver materials, including concrete, clay, and natural stone, to match existing driveway surfaces.
